Overview from the Stamping course of action

The stamping approach could be the important initial phase within the creation of steel bipolar plates, laying the muse for their performance in a variety of apps, significantly gas cells. This process includes the use of advanced molding strategies to produce intricate and hugely in depth styles with exact specifications that guarantee optimal general performance. The molds Participate in a significant purpose in protecting uniformity and accuracy, as even the slightest deviation could affect the effectiveness on the bipolar plates. to accomplish this, higher-driven hydraulic presses, effective at creating nominal forces of up to 20,000 kN, are employed. These presses not only present the required drive to form the metal but additionally greatly enhance manufacturing effectiveness by way of rapid stamping cycles. This minimizes production time, cuts down charges, and maximizes throughput, enabling suppliers to meet the rising need for top-general performance gas cell parts. Just about every phase is meticulously managed to make sure high quality and dependability, making the stamping approach an indispensable A part of the manufacturing chain.

Cleaning, Welding, and Coating strategies

After stamping, the plates undergo a radical cleaning procedure to get rid of any contaminants, for instance oils, debris, or residues, making certain a easy, pristine surface area for another generation measures. Superior cleansing systems are utilized, which may be customized to meet precise production prerequisites with regards to measurement and throughput, optimizing performance for giant-scale production. after cleaned, precision laser welding is utilized to be part of the stamped plates, producing total bipolar plates. This process makes certain a superior standard of accuracy, with laser welding offering Excellent regularity, power, and longevity during the welds. The use of substantial-quality products, coupled with demanding high quality Management expectations, assures the dependability and longevity of the ultimate merchandise. soon after welding, the plates are subjected to a specialised surface therapy that improves their resistance to corrosion, enhances Total longevity, and boosts functionality in demanding environments, producing them appropriate for slicing-edge applications for example gas cells and Superior Electricity methods.

Sealing and screening Protocols

Sealing and tests are important to guaranteeing the dependability and overall performance of steel bipolar plates Employed in gasoline cells. higher-good quality sealing steps are meticulously applied more info to be certain airtight disorders, which happen to be essential for the efficient Procedure of gasoline cells by protecting against any gas leakage that may compromise functionality. These sealing techniques normally involve State-of-the-art supplies and precision software approaches to resist various operational conditions. Besides sealing, rigorous tests protocols are executed To judge strength, toughness, and Total overall performance. These tests simulate actual-globe circumstances, including exposure to Serious temperatures, strain variations, and long-time period use, to make certain Each individual plate meets or exceeds market benchmarks. The tests procedure may additionally involve chemical resistance assessments to confirm the plates' skill to operate efficiently in really reactive environments. this kind of meticulous sealing and testing processes safeguard the plates' performance and assure their extended-phrase trustworthiness across A variety of gasoline mobile programs, from transportable devices to big-scale Power devices. Integration of MES and smart Logistics programs

The Metal Bipolar Plate Molding creation Line incorporates Highly developed Manufacturing Execution methods (MES) and clever logistics systems for exceptional workflow management. MES devices present serious-time monitoring and Charge of the manufacturing system, ensuring that every phase operates efficiently. Intelligent logistics more streamline substance handling, feeding functions, and discharge procedures. With precision feeding programs enabling accuracies of ±0.2 mm/m and discharge line speeds of around 16 m/min, productivity is enhanced, decreasing delays and ensuring seamless Procedure.
